Article Summaries:
- Hyundai and Kia have slashed prices on several electric models in South Korea to counter recent cuts by rivals BYD and Tesla. Hyundai announced a new promotion that reduces interest rates on the IONIQ 5, IONIQ 6 and Kona Electric from 5.4 % to 2.8 %, and offers up to 6 million won ($4,100) in savings through monthly promos, early‑bird specials and trade‑in deals. Buyers can defer payments for 36 months and pay a lump sum at the end. Kia’s earlier price cuts of up to 3 million won and 0 % interest plan mirror Hyundai’s move, intensifying the EV price war in the Korean market.
